 Back In Black: One of the Greatest Hard Rock Heavy Metal Albums of All Time | File Type: audio/mpeg | Duration: 59:26

Lou and Katie take you all the way back to 1980 for the release AC/DC's tour de'force; Back In Black. With 6 of the 10 tracks in heavy radio rotation, AC/DC demonstrated to the world that heavy rock is alive and well and here to stay.

 Loudini Interviews Larry Coryell | File Type: audio/mpeg | Duration: 41:31

As one of the pioneers of jazz-rock -- perhaps the pioneer in the ears of some -- Larry Coryell deserves a special place in the history books. He brought what amounted to a nearly alien sensibility to jazz electric guitar playing in the 1960s, a hard-edged, cutting tone, phrasing and note-bending that owed as much to blues, rock and even country as it did to earlier, smoother bop influences.

 Loudini Interviews Vijay of InRegalia | File Type: audio/mpeg | Duration: 28:59

Born in Mangalore, Vijay's talent was imminent at an early age having won several local guitar and singing competitions. Music, though took a back seat for six years due to the pressure of academics. But destiny had other plans and brought him back to where he belonged - playing music. The journey from an acoustic folk guitarist to an accomplished Rock Lead/Rhythm guitarist has brought with it experience in Rock & Soul bands to which he blends in pop and ethnic sensibilities. Some of his guitar heroes and influences are Jimmy Page, Ritchie Blackmore and Angus Young. "The journey to musical fulfillment is endless " he says.
